Electronic Databases provided by UNT Libraries can be accessed by any UNT student, faculty, or staff member from virtually any computer in the world.
Campus Access
Connecting to Electronic Databases on any of the UNT Campuses (Denton, Discovery Park, Health Science, or Dallas) is available via:
- UNT Campus: Any wired computer in the libraries or on campus.
- UNT Wireless Network: Access the campus wireless network. (Requires EUID/Password Authentication, See Below)
Off-Campus & Wireless Access
Most subscription based Electronic Databases will require you to login with your EUID and password.

Logging Out
Some subscription systems have a limited number of "simultaneous users" or have other unusual internal logging out requirements. Because of this:
- Whenever you finish using an electronic product, look for a "log out" or "log off" button, typically on the right side of the screen.
- Click on it to exit. This frees up the product so others can use it.
